WebDurkheim, Émile (1858–1917) A French sociologist who explored links between social integration and suicide rates. Durkheim hypothesized that members of groups that lacked a high degree of social integration were more likely to commit suicide. WebEmile Durkheim was a French sociologist who is considered to be one of the founders of modern sociology. He is known for his contributions to the study of social order, social cohesion, and social integration. Durkheim was born in 1858 in France and studied at the École Normale Supérieure in Paris.
